1968
The Rolling Stones – Beggars Banquet
Beggars Banquet is a seminal rock album for its raw, blues-infused sound and return to the band’s roots. It marked a turning point, showcasing the Stones’ gritty, rebellious energy and lyrical boldness. Tracks like “Sympathy for the Devil” and “Street Fighting Man” capture the social tension of the era, while exploring themes of conflict, desire, and defiance with swagger and sophistication. This album redefined the Stones’ image and influence, establishing them as rock’s anti-heroes and setting the stage for their dominance in the years that followed.
